Q: Is 933,276 a Prime Number?
A: No, 933,276 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 933276 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 12 77,773 155,546 233,319 311,092 466,638 and 933,276, with no remainder.
Since 933,276 cannot be divided by just 1 and 933,276, it is not a prime number.
